Connecting a GNS3 router to a real Catalyst switch

So I've got my 8-port Cisco Catalyst 2960 Layer 2 switch, which I purchased for a really great price on Ebay. A cool feature of the WS-C2960PD-8TT-L versus the WS-C2960-8TC-L model is that you can power it up using its PoE uplink port. I've powered up the 2960 using my 3560 PoE multilayer switch.


3560#
00:01:47: %ILPOWER-7-DETECT: Interface Fa0/8: Power Device detected: IEEE PD
3560#show power inline
Available:124.0(w)  Used:15.4(w)  Remaining:108.6(w)

Interface Admin  Oper       Power   Device              Class Max
                            (Watts)
--------- ------ ---------- ------- ------------------- ----- ----
Fa0/1     auto   off        0.0     n/a                 n/a   15.4
Fa0/2     auto   off        0.0     n/a                 n/a   15.4
Fa0/3     auto   off        0.0     n/a                 n/a   15.4
Fa0/4     auto   off        0.0     n/a                 n/a   15.4
Fa0/5     auto   off        0.0     n/a                 n/a   15.4
Fa0/6     auto   off        0.0     n/a                 n/a   15.4
Fa0/7     auto   off        0.0     n/a                 n/a   15.4
Fa0/8     auto   on         15.4    WS-C2960PD-8TT-L    3     15.4


I've also tested this switch with an emulated router in GNS3 using a 802.1Q trunk port. We checked the Ethernet (wired) LAN adapter if its enabled and supports VLAN by going to Network and Sharing Center > Change adapter settings > right-click on the Local Area Connection > double-click Internet Protocol Version 4 (TCP/IPv4) > Properties > Advanced tab > Priority and VLAN.


We connect our PC's Ethernet LAN to a switch port, drag a cloud icon in GNS3 workspace > Right-click > Configure > NIO Ethernet > Select the Local Area Connection adapter and then click OK.

Setting up My Cisco 871w Home Lab Router

I've searched on the Internet what's the best router for a CCNA lab and learned from Wendell Odom's blog that he chose the 1700 as the winner. But the idea of having a "wired" router doesn't appeal to me when networks nowadays have converted to wireless. It's still cool though to have a 1721 router someday for my lab (if budget permits it).

So I've decided to buy a Cisco 871w router on Ebay, which supports wireless (not to mention IOS 15.0), not too long ago and replaced my existing Linksys E1200 at home. I've configured it one night and here's the configuration that worked for me and the troubleshooting I went through. Another cool thing having this router is that I can configure it remotely using my iPhone or iPad with this free app.




We configure a bridge group and enable IRB (Integrated Routing and Bridging) to "bridge" network traffic and routing protocols between a logical bridge interface and the routed (Layer 3) interface.

I've hardcoded these commands under the FE4 (WAN) interface since I suspected the MAC address of my Linksys E1200 could still be cached or locked at the ISP side. After rebooting the cable modem and then BOOM there it was, I've finally got an IP address.


871W(config-if)#ip dhcp client client-id hex 002699c6db2e 
871W(config-if)#ip dhcp client hostname 871W
